Summary:

The Manchester Essex Regional High School is the sole high school serving the Manchester Essex Regional district in Massachusetts. This standout school has consistently ranked among the top high schools in the state, earning a 5-star rating from SchoolDigger for the 2024-2025 school year and placing 22nd out of 349 Massachusetts high schools.

Manchester Essex Regional High School's academic performance is exceptional, with MCAS proficiency rates significantly higher than the state averages across all subject areas and grade levels. For example, in 2024-2025, 82.35% of 10th graders were proficient or better in ELA and Math, compared to state averages of 50.66% and 44.6% respectively. The school also boasts a 97.8% 4-year graduation rate and a low 1.1% dropout rate, indicating a strong focus on student success.

The school's success is further supported by its resource allocation, with a relatively high spending of $19,597 per student and a low student-teacher ratio of 9.7, suggesting a commitment to providing a quality education for its students. While the data does not provide information on the school's free/reduced lunch rates, the overall picture painted by the available metrics demonstrates that Manchester Essex Regional High School is a standout educational institution in the region, delivering excellent academic outcomes for its students.
